>>58737366I have an idea based on a fan theory I have.Ho-oh and Lugia are the guardian pokemon of both Johto and Kanto as they are originally one region. They split up duties by each watching over one side of Mt. Silver, which is called that because Lugia has to cross the Mountain from its tower. However, when Lugia's tower burned down it caused Lugia to not be able to properly look after Kanto. This led to several issues, such as the Legendary Birds (Lugia's underlings who roost in Kanto) becoming aggressive with each other. And without it's guardian diety, the people of Kanto slowly lost their faith in the old traditions. Instead they began to rapidly modernize with technology to fill the gap that Lugia's absence left. Maybe after the tower burned down the people of Kanto blamed Johto and Ho-oh for Lugia vanishing, tensions escalated, and the region split into two as war broke out.

>>58740493>stronger affinity for off-type movesThat feels kind of unrelated. Types were just an example but I meant knowledge in general. Most wild Pokemon have never seen a Pokedex, never read a history book, and wouldn't pass basic human knowledge checks. They might instinctively understand their own abilities and natural predators/prey but what happens when you take them out of their habitat? They don't have a breadth of knowledge to generalize with.Knowledge is the difference between meeting an exotic pokemon and thinking>Wow who is this tiny cute girl who smells so sweet? new pokewaifuvs>What can I infer about this unknown Pokemon from its physical characteristics? That venus fly trap shape on its head may indicate it is a predatorvs >That is Mawile. It is luring us in to eat us and it's weak to fire
